90mm cylinders like an RS and a 66mm stroke crankshaft. This version can rev higher for longer.
The other version uses the 70.4mm stroke. That was the first on the 911ST used, with Biral cylinders. They had issues with the flywheels coming loose due to a torsional vibration harmonic in the crankshaft that would hit at a bit over 8000rpm, which was where the racers like to rev them. The short stroke version came out next when the factory applied their Nickasil technology from Mahle that they had developed for the 917. This allowed 90mm and larger cylinder bores. The short stroke crankshaft has the harmonic torsional vibration shifted up further in the rev range, beyond where it is a problem. |

We recently built a 2.45 70.4 x 86 with 9.0:1 compression.
We used DC Mod "S" cams and 40mm Webers. Heads were ported to "S" specs 36mm. SSI exhaust and an M&K muffler. We also added twin plug to add to the wow but hardly needed with 9.0:1. We chose this combination because we wanted to use the matching numbers case(2.2T) and I really don't like bore the spigots to fit 90 mm cylinders. The project made 180 RWhp @ 6500rpm without tuning. We just built it, used the jetting recommended by PMO and set the timing. Once it's broken in the owner will dyno it again with the intent of running it at a higher RPM and tuning to achieve the best running conditions. You can use your 3R case but I would have it shuffle-pinned if you intend on 7K operation. We started with 2.7 heads for the above engine and they have been extensively modified for this application as thats where the power is,...:) We also machined them for twin-ignition as thats required for higher compression ratios and/or compatibility with pump gasolines. |
